Understanding Florida's Trees
Florida is home to a wide variety of tree species, from majestic live oaks to beautiful palm trees. Each type requires specific care to thrive. The state's warm climate and frequent storms can impact tree health, making regular maintenance crucial. Proper trimming helps trees withstand high winds and promotes healthy growth.
Identifying the trees on your property helps determine the best approach for trimming and removal. Knowledge of native species and their growth patterns can inform your maintenance decisions, ensuring long-lasting health and beauty for your landscape.
Importance of Regular Tree Trimming
Regular tree trimming is not just about aesthetics; it's vital for tree health and safety. Trimming removes dead or diseased branches, preventing them from falling and causing damage during storms. It also promotes air circulation and sunlight penetration, which are crucial for healthy growth.

Moreover, well-trimmed trees enhance the appearance of your property, potentially increasing its value. They can also improve the overall health of your garden by reducing competition for sunlight and nutrients among plants.
When to Trim Your Trees
Timing is key when it comes to tree trimming. In Florida, the best time to trim most trees is during the dormant season, typically late winter or early spring. However, certain species may have different requirements, so it's crucial to understand the specific needs of the trees in your landscape.
The Process of Tree Removal
Tree removal is a more complex task that requires professional expertise. Safety is paramount, as improper removal can lead to property damage or personal injury. Professionals assess the tree's condition, location, and potential hazards before proceeding with removal.

The process involves several steps, including securing the area, cutting down the tree safely, and removing debris. In some cases, stump grinding may be necessary to prevent regrowth and pests.

Sustainability Practices in Tree Management
Many tree service companies in Florida are adopting sustainable practices. This includes recycling wood waste into mulch or biofuel, planting new trees to replace those removed, and using eco-friendly equipment.
By choosing companies that prioritize sustainability, you contribute to preserving Florida's natural beauty while ensuring your property remains safe and attractive.
